AP Reporter Apologizes After Cutting Babyface Interview Short for Chappell Roan at Grammys, Sparking Controversy | Video
Grammy Awards Sunday, an awkward moment unfolded when two Associated Press reporters, Krysta Fauria and Leslie Ambriz, cut short their interview with legendary producer and songwriter Babyface to speak with singer Chappell Roan instead.
AP issues apology to Babyface for cutting interview short. What happened
Babyface was mid-sentence during an interview with two Associated Press reporters when one called out to another artist behind him. Backlash ensued.
AP apologizes for abruptly ending Babyface interview for Chappell Roan on Grammys red carpet
Leslie Ambriz, alongside Krysta Fauria, greeted Kenneth "Babyface" Edmonds during AP's live red carpet show by calling him a "legend." They discussed how the fires that have ravaged Los Angeles have brought the community together and how music helped the multi-Grammy winning talent process his emotions.
